Outcomes Table

Funding Committees score applications on a range of 1-10. This table displays the mean score for each application that was assessed in the Stage 1 assessment committee meeting. At Stage 1, an application scoring in the range 8 -10 is invited to Stage 2. Applications with a mean score of 6-7 have the potential to be invited to Stage 2, at the discretion of the Committee. In exceptional circumstances, and with approval from the Programme Director, applications may be invited which fall below the potentially invite to Stage 2 range.
